MONTAGE MARKETS

Montage Markets 2025
Sat 22nd February 2025 | Sat 15th March 2025
11am - 4pm
More dates to be added throughout the year
Our markets showcase a diverse range of art forms, including painting, textiles, clay work, and much more. In addition to artwork, you'll discover an array of unique items such as handmade jewellery, artisan handbags, and delicious homemade cakes—all crafted by our talented local artists and makers.

FEATURED MAKERS
At Good Fruit Garden, Hope & Marianna love creating meaningful, faith-inspired gifts that encourage and uplift others, sharing their hope in Jesus Christ. Their journey began with Hope’s beautiful Bible-inspired paintings, which she transferred onto paper as a composer would craft a symphony. Now, Good Fruit Garden is working to turn Hope’s original designs into a variety of handmade gifts, including cards, coasters, calendars, mugs, and ceramics.
Rosemary is a fine artist, painter, and writer with a passion for experimenting across different media. Her work is rooted in mark-making, often exploring abstract forms that capture movement, energy, and emotion. She finds joy both in creating and appreciating abstract art, always eager to try new techniques and push creative boundaries.

Anne creates bags and purses using recycled materials, transforming items that might otherwise be discarded into unique accessories. Each bag is crafted, combining creativity with environmental awareness. All proceeds from sales are donated to Mountbatten Isle of Wight, an independent charity that cares for Islanders with life-limiting conditions and their families.

EXHIBITION

FREE Exhibition
Bird is the word
A narrative exhibition
1st – 11th May 2025
Artist Rosemary Lawrey
We are thrilled to welcome Rosemary back to the Depository, where she will once again be showcasing her stunning artwork.
'When I first came to the Island seven years ago, I had no close friends or family here – it was the gulls who lined up along the pier railings to welcome me off the ferry. Birds have a way of being present in every glance through the window, their songs a constant backdrop, pitched high above the drone of urban life, their movements stirring the air around us whether or not we notice it. Since my arrival, the Island birdlife has found its way into more of my paintings than I realised, and this exhibition is a reflection of just how important being surrounded by these lively and mysterious beings is in our daily lives.' Rosemary Lawrey
